Just as Dhruv is about to articulate his love, Shahid abruptly interrupts the conversation. This leaves the confession hanging in mid-air, saving Nandini from an immediate, awkward confrontation but heightening the dramatic tension for the episodes to come.

In the 61st episode of Kaisi Yeh Yaariaan ("Boy Interrupted"), tension peaks as Dhruv’s confession to Nandini is interrupted by Shahid, while Manik officially breaks up with Alya and navigates his growing feelings for Nandini amidst loyalty to his friend.
